c语言编程笔录

您现在的位置是:首页 > 编程 > 编程经验

编程经验

基于PHP的数据爬取器原理及应用

阮建安 2023-08-14编程经验
前言数据爬取是一种通过程序自动从互联网上获取数据的技术。在现代社会中,大量的数据分布在不同的网站上,如果需要获取这些数据并进行分析、处理或展示,手动复制粘贴显然是低效且耗时的。因此,使用数据爬取器来自动化这个过程是非常重要的。PHP作为一

前言

数据爬取是一种通过程序自动从互联网上获取数据的技术。在现代社会中,大量的数据分布在不同的网站上,如果需要获取这些数据并进行分析、处理或展示,手动复制粘贴显然是低效且耗时的。因此,使用数据爬取器来自动化这个过程是非常重要的。

PHP作为一种脚本语言,非常适合用于构建数据爬取器。它具有强大的处理HTML页面和HTTP请求的功能,同时拥有丰富的第三方库和工具,使得数据爬取变得更加简单和高效。

数据爬取器原理

数据爬取器的工作原理可以大致分为以下几个步骤:

1. 确定目标网站和需要爬取的数据:首先需要选择需要爬取的目标网站,并确定需要采集的数据类型和内容。

2. 发起HTTP请求:通过PHP的网络请求库,发送HTTP请求到目标网站的服务器,并获取相应的HTML页面。

3. 解析HTML页面:使用PHP的HTML解析库,将获取到的HTML页面进行解析,提取出需要的数据。

4. 存储数据:将解析出的数据存储到数据库、文件或其他存储介质中,以供后续使用。

数据爬取器应用

数据爬取器的应用非常广泛,下面是一些常见的应用场景:

1. 新闻数据采集:新闻网站每天更新大量的新闻,使用数据爬取器可以自动抓取这些新闻,并进行关键词提取、分析等进一步处理。

2. 商品信息采集:电商网站上有海量的商品信息,使用数据爬取器可以抓取这些信息,并进行价格对比、数据分析等操作。

3. 股票数据分析:使用数据爬取器获取实时的股票数据,进行股票行情分析和趋势预测。

4. 社交媒体监测:通过数据爬取器抓取社交媒体上的信息和评论,进行舆情分析和用户行为研究。

总结

数据爬取器是一种帮助我们自动获取互联网上数据的工具。通过使用PHP编写数据爬取器,我们可以实现对目标网站的数据获取、解析和存储。数据爬取器在新闻采集、商品信息采集、股票数据分析和社交媒体监测等领域有着广泛的应用。对于全栈程序员来说,掌握数据爬取的技术不仅可以提升工作效率,还可以开发出更多有用的功能。

文章评论